Dynamic Deck Construction in Shifting Ecosystems
Unlike standard ranked modes where player configurations remain relatively static, competitive adventure modes introduce random variables that disrupt optimized formulas. Participants must build flexible decks capable of handling unpredictable boss mechanics and sudden tactical restrictions imposed by the campaign environment. Success depends heavily on a player's capability to read incoming environmental changes and adjust synergies accordingly.
Furthermore, these modes frequently reward individuals who can master niche card combinations that are usually ignored in standard multiplayer brackets. This structural variance encourages organic experimentation and keeps the active gameplay ecosystem from becoming stale. Meticulous preparation and deep mechanical comprehension serve as the main pillars for securing top ranks within these temporary seasonal campaigns.
Strategic Resource Management Across Extended Runs
A defining characteristic of competitive adventure formats is the persistence of health metrics and deck degradation across multiple sequential battles. Players cannot simply rely on all-out offensive combinations, as damage sustained in early stages will negatively impact performance in subsequent encounters. This mechanical structure forces tactical masters to prioritize protective shields, restorative abilities, and sustainable energy generation.
Managing a limited inventory pool throughout a long campaign run adds an incredible layer of cognitive tension to every decision. Choosing when to deploy rare high-tier cards or conserve energy can make the difference between a record-breaking run and a premature defeat. This structural complexity appeals directly to veterans looking for a deeply intellectual challenge on portable screens.
